Skip to content
This repository has been archived by the owner on Jan 7, 2023. It is now read-only.

Animações JS

SardonyxAnimals edited this page Dec 7, 2020 · 1 revision

Nós utilizamos JS para a animação dos cards na página sobre.html, de modo que, quando o usuário clica sobre a foto de um dos componentes da Sardonyx, a foto preenche todo o card.

O código de implementação desse pode ser encontrado no diretório js/js_sobre.js:

const img = document.querySelector("img");
const icons = document.querySelector(".icons");
img.onclick = function() {
    this.classList.toggle("active");
    icons.classList.toggle("active");
}

Além disso, uma animação que, ao usuário clicar sobre o botão, esse é redirecionado até o topo da página, podendo encontrar o header e outras informações.

O código de implementação desse pode ser encontrado no diretório js/botoes.js:

$(function() {
    $(window).scroll(function() {
        if ($(this).scrollTop() > 60) {
            $('#navegacao').addClass('navevagacao-fixed-top', 500);
        } else {
            $('#navegacao').removeClass('navegacao-fixed-top', 500);
        }
    });
});




Clone this wiki locally